Using an ROV (robotic unmanned sub), we took video of animals off of Bailey Island, Maine. In this video, we come upon a lobster trap.
The video was taken using Captain James Jone's ROV (http://www.nauticvideo.com/ ). The video is being used by the Log Cabin Inn (http://www.logcabin-maine.com/ ) to show guests what lives underwater in front of the inn.
